The discussion about the quality of wet and dry mixing processes is going on in many countries of the world for years, mostly with a more emotional than a technical background. Therefore, a number of leading companies who are supplying concrete mixers to the industry realized the need for an independent research study. These companies (IME, IMER, OMG-SICOMA) are supplying concrete mixers of different type: Twin shaft mixers and planetary mixers. As a neutral research institute, the Italian Concrete Institute was asked to provide services and to effect tests in order to fulfil a comparative research on the characteristics of concretes, produced using a dry mix process and a wet mix process. The research is meant to identify possible quality differences between the concrete produced using a stationary concrete mixer (wet mix process) and concrete produced by direct loading of the components into a truck mixer (dry mix process). This article is a summary of the complete research study carried out by the Italian Concrete Institute [1].
